Anililagnia
//əˌnɪ.ləˈlæɡ.niə// noun
noun ·Rare ·Advanced level
Definitions
Noun
- 1 An attraction to women much older than oneself uncountable
"2010, Alisdair Macdowell, Anililagnia, or, the Age Question Part II, The Rakish Life [M]y anililagnia is not all pragmatism and no passion. Rather, I have found that only a woman who has had many lovers can appreciate a truly exceptional one."

Etymology
From anile + -lagnia.
